#a17b56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a17b56 is composed of 63.1% red, 48.2%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.6% magenta, 46.6%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 29.6 degrees, a saturation of 30.4% and a lightness of 48.4%. #a17b56 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ff6ac with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#a17b56 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#a17b56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a17b56 has RGB values of R:161, G:123,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.47,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10582870.
